摘要
提出一种基于粒子群优化算法的排课算法,通过粒子编码、适应值函数构建、粒子群初始化和交叉操作等,使适应值函数能够随着进化代数的增加而呈不断下降的趋势,从而很好地解决了教务系统中的排课问题.
A new algorithm for timetabling based on particle swarm optimization algorithm was proposed,and the key problems such as particle coding,adaptive value function fabricating,particle swarm initialization and mutual operation were settled.The fitness value declines when the evolution generation increases.The results showed that it was a good solution for course timetabling problem in the educational system.
出处
《郑州轻工业学院学报(自然科学版)》
CAS
2010年第6期49-52,共4页
Journal of Zhengzhou University of Light Industry:Natural Science
关键词
粒子群优化算法
排课系统
适应值函数
particle swarm optimization algorithm
timetabling
fitness function